Troubleshooting Browser-Related Problems
Addressing browser-related issues typically involves a series of straightforward steps. First and foremost, ensure your browser is up-to-date. Outdated browsers often lack the necessary security features and compatibility updates to interact seamlessly with modern web applications. Clearing the browser's cache and cookies can also resolve many login problems, as these stored files can sometimes contain outdated or corrupted information. Finally, disabling browser extensions, particularly those related to security or ad-blocking, can help identify whether a conflict is causing the login issue. Trying a different browser altogether can serve as a diagnostic step, determining if the problem is specific to your usual browsing environment. This simple step reveals if the issue is with the platform or your browser setup.

Two-Factor Authentication and Security Settings
In today’s digital environment, security is paramount. Implementing two-factor authentication (2FA) is a significant step in bolstering your account security. 2FA adds an extra layer of protection by requiring a second verification method—typically a code sent to your mobile device—in addition to your password. This makes it significantly more difficult for unauthorized users to gain access to your account, even if they somehow obtain your password. Beyond 2FA, familiarizing yourself with the platform’s security settings is essential. This includes reviewing and updating your privacy settings, managing authorized devices, and monitoring your account activity for any suspicious behavior. Regularly changing your password, especially after a potential security breach, is also a best practice.
Understanding Security Questions
Security questions, though sometimes perceived as a nuisance, serve as an important fallback mechanism for account recovery. However, it’s essential to choose security questions and answers that are both memorable to you and difficult for others to guess. Avoid using common knowledge or easily obtainable personal information like your mother’s maiden name or your birthdate. Instead, opt for questions with more obscure answers that only you would know. Be consistent with your answers and store them securely, potentially using a password manager designed for storing sensitive information. This can ensure that you can successfully recover your account should you ever forget your password or encounter a security breach.
